When a balloon is attached to an edge in SolidWorks, it typically includes an arrow. Balloons are used in drawings to reference components in a bill of materials or to indicate items in an assembly. The arrow signifies the component to which the balloon is pointing, making it clear which part is being referenced or identified.

In a typical usage scenario, the balloon will not only provide a visual connection with the component but may also include additional information, such as a part number or quantity. However, the essential feature that distinguishes a balloon and makes it functional in the context of technical drawings is the presence of the arrow, as it directs attention to the relevant part in the assembly.
